Contemplative Spiritual Formation Committee
Who we are: Offering contemplative practices, including prayers of silence, which make us more aware of the divine indwelling in everyone, we are LGBTIQ+ Catholics and contemplatives who gather every other Saturday in a prayerful space graciously offered by the Meditation Chapel-Online Meditation Community (https://meditationchapel.org/).
We aspire to become a “Centre of Inwardness” without borders and where everyone is welcome. By welcoming everyone as Christ himself, we have become a diverse group of people coming from different backgrounds and countries.
